The relevance of the work is due to the lack of a physical interpretation of the process of extinguishing jet burning systems with fire extinguishing powders, which is important for ensuring effective fire extinguishing at gas and oil complexes and hazardous chemical industries. A mathematical model of the reaction kinetics of heterogeneous inhibition of active flame centers of a jet burning system by fire extinguishing powder particles in an unsteady mode is considered in the approximation of a purely molecular transfer of matter in the reaction zone. The regularities of the mechanism of heterogeneous inhibition of the active flame centers by the particles of the extinguishing powder under conditions when the active particles of the combustion products participate not only in diffuse, but also in convective transport are established. It is shown, that the convective motion of the active flame centers increases the reaction rate of heterogeneous inhibition of their particles of the extinguishing agent. The results obtained allow us to optimize the conditions for the supply of fire extinguishing powder to the jet burning medium for effective flame suppression.

The kinetics of charging the blocked (inert) electrode/ solid electrolyte interface was studied by operational impedance method in the galvanodynamic and potentiodynamic modes. For calculations the equivalent electrical scheme of Jacobsen and West method was used which is suitable in the case of long time of charging. The participation of two different electrochemically active particles in a process of delayed diffusion and adsorption-desorption was taken into account.

This work is devoted to the study of the interaction of chemically active particles with the silicon surface in the process of deep anisotropic etching using the Cryo method. A method is proposed for quantitative estimation of kinetics of particles based on the adsorption-desorption model of Langmuir adsorption kinetics.
